This coin shows the image of a Celtic Raith grass cross which was worn by members of a Scottish clan as an amulet. The equilateral cross represents the four seasons, spring, summer, autumn and winter. This is how you can see the amulets task because people believed it kept the seasons in balance en would take care of welfare during the whole year.
